Anchors

Anchors are predefined reference points or targets used in machine learning models to improve accuracy during training. They serve as known benchmarks that guide the model’s understanding, helping it learn more effectively by providing context or specific examples. For example, in facial recognition, an anchor might be a verified image of a person’s face, which the system uses to compare and identify other images. Essentially, anchors help models focus on important features and improve their ability to make accurate predictions by anchoring their learning process around reliable reference points.
